Analysis

India recorded 0.6% for repeaters, primary, total in 2018.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 5.3% on the previous year and down 83.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, repeaters, primary, total in India peaked at 20.8% in 1971 and was at its lowest, 0.5%, in 2016.

That places India 134th out of 189 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Repeaters in primary school are the number of students enrolled in the same grade as in the previous year, as a percentage of all students enrolled in primary school.
